Breaking: Television Political Correspondents Are Manipulative, Catty
Photo: Courtesy of ABC News
ABC's Jake Tapper, Fox News' Griff Jenkins, and CNN's John King were among the TV news personalities that privately slagged off on other outlets' coverage in an effort to win a sit-down with disgraced South Carolina governor Mark Sanford. Of course, none of their efforts were successful, and none of us are surprised. [NYT]
